This MCP server provides read-only access to VirtualFlyBrain public APIs with no authentication requirements. While the core functionality is safe, there are concerning practices around analytics tracking: hardcoded GA4 credentials in the code, fire-and-forget network calls that exfiltrate tool arguments to Google Analytics, and inadequate input validation on search parameters that could be exploited. The server appropriately scopes permissions to public API queries, but the analytics implementation and lack of input sanitization present moderate security and privacy risks. Supply chain analysis found 3 known vulnerabilities in dependencies (0 critical, 1 high severity).

A Model Context Protocol (MCP) server for interacting with VirtualFlyBrain (VFB) APIs. This server provides tools to query VFB data, run queries, and search for terms.
The easiest way to use VFB3-MCP is through our hosted service at https://vfb3-mcp.virtualflybrain.org. This requires no installation or setup on your machine.

Clone the repository:
git clone https://github.com/Robbie1977/VFB3-MCP.git
cd VFB3-MCP
Install dependencies:
npm install
Build the project:
npm run build
Start the server:
npm start

Retrieve detailed information about VFB terms using their IDs.
Parameters:
id (string): VFB ID (e.g., "VFB_jrcv0i43")Execute predefined queries on VFB data.
Parameters:
id (string): VFB ID (e.g., "VFB_00101567")query_type (string): Type of query (e.g., "PaintedDomains")Search for VFB terms using the Solr search server.
Parameters:
query (string): Search query (e.g., "medulla")VirtualFlyBrain (VFB) is a comprehensive knowledge base about Drosophila melanogaster neurobiology, providing 3D images, gene expression data, neural connectivity information, and standardized terminology for fly brain research.
